Against the tan sand gleams the white body of a mare. This body, once toned and strong, now seems to be much thinner, weaker. Wispy white, her mane and tail flutter gently in the breeze of the ocean. She lay there for a while before burying her nose in the sun-warmed sand and then looking out listlessly at the ocean before her. It was so vast and she so small. If only she could be that vast, if only she'd been that vast when Paladin had challenged her position as lead of the Foothills.

While her next thought was certainly not charitable, she thought it anyways: she hoped his kingdom had all gone to shit.

Then she released a great, big sigh. The sand covering her nose blew out in a big puff about her and, for a moment, she appeared like some odd, white elephant seal sunning herself upon the beach. She really had ought to stop dwelling upon that, she scolded herself. "Yes, love, you really ought to. Life moves on, as must you. You must find your own place in this world, just as Enna has..." ,thought Lazulli at her. Oh yes, Enna. The Benevolent recalls the words her daughter had uttered upon their parting. Such fire which had been there, such a stronger mare which was apparent. Ah, alas, Enna would make her entrance whenever she felt it was fit. She shifted her weight and one could just see the edges of the marking for virtue upon her right shoulder. The necklace made by Narmer to hold her amulet soon rubbed against her though, so she decided to just flop over completely on the sand and sprawl out.

She had left the herd and traveled with Enna and Eios over Loorien, to different lands with different gods...together, at least for a time. Wandering yet again. Both Enna and Eios eventually branched off on their own and she was left to wander alone. To meander amongst only one's thoughts often allows for greater reflection than if the horse had been in company anyways. Though she deliberated for many months on it, she had come to the conclusion that her choice to lead had not been wrong. The experience had only made her grow. However, it had also caused her to realize that, through the adventure, she should never again stray into the area of battle and leads. She wasn't quite sure what she wanted to do yet. She wasn't even sure if she wanted to meet her old friends either. Gods, she certainly didn't want to even contemplate the complications of her relationship with Indy. Was there even one left?

The white mare soon felt Lazulli's scorn enter her head again and replied in annoyance, "Oh shush, I'm allowed to mourn the stallion with whom I've spent nearly my entire life. It would be as if you had lost me." At that Lazulli backed off with all the pressure and flopped down next to her in the sand. Lax, lazy, and languid they both lay there, thinking of nothing in particular any longer. To any whom decided to pass by the two would seem dead and, for those who knew them, they'd be easily recognizable. Gossamer was well aware that she might be seen like this, all.. well...sandy and lacking her pristine grace. Frankly though, she didn't much care any longer, her time of power was up and she fully intended to enjoy retirement.
